The Inglis Gold Yearling Sale will be held at Oaklands on Thursday and the most represented sire is Widden Stud’s Melbourne Cup winner Fiorente (IRE), so if you are in the market for a budding young stayer read on.

Fiorente is the sire of eight SW's inc. Lunar Flare, stars of Carrum, Hawkshot and Liquero.

A proven source of quality stayers, notably this season with Group II MVRC Moonee Valley Cup winner Lunar Flare, Fiorente has a great crop of yearlings this year bred in 2019 when he stood for $27,500.


As a result, he has 13 entries for Inglis Gold and they are nearly all from Black Type families, click to see the full draft with some highlights below:

Lot 1 Colt Fiorente (IRE) x Vanity Sky, by Mossman


Half-brother to SW I Am Someone.

Lot 64 Colt Fiorente (IRE) x Desert Lashes, by Reward for Effort

First foal from brilliant stakes-winning sprinter Desert Lashes.

Lot 91 Colt Fiorente (IRE) x Henriette (NZ), by Pins
 


Half-brother to SW Jaquetta.
